The Recaro PP is the most popular race seat with the E46 M3 crowd. I love them for their comfort. However, the don't fit me well in race application because the holes for the shoulder belts are too small and too low for me (I'm 6'2'') and don't give enough legs support. But for a mix of street and track, they are the best for me. Comfortable enough for 3-4 hours rides, daily driving and track days. |

+1 on PP's... after finding the right angle, I find them to be extremely comfortable and supportive. It's perfect for track and street. If I was driving a dedicated track car, I'd change the seat with more head protection but no way you could drive that on street.
My lower back would give out with the oem m-sport seats for any drive more than 3+ hrs, or after a day on the track. Not the case with my PP's. |
